Boss: "Chuma Has Shown The Way After Taking His Opportunity"

10 January 2020

David Artell has praised the professionalism of Chuma Anene after he stepped into the boots of leading scorer, Chris Porter to front our festive period. Porter was forced off in the first half against Eastleigh in the FA Cup replay with a hamstring injury and Chuma grabbed his opportunity then and there when scoring a brace in a deserved 3-1 that evening.

The powerful Norwegian has continued to lead the line in Porter’s absence and is now just two goals behind our leading marksman in the race to finish as the club’s leading scorer at the end of the season.

Artell told crewealex.net: “Chris had a really good return of goals in the first half of the season. He has ten in just over 20 games and that is terrific.

“Now Chuma has come in and extended that and he has 8 in about 10 starts and that is terrific also. It is a similar ratio and that is what we need. He has stepped up to the plate.

“Chuma is a terrific player and has great character. He is an excellent professional and he has a great work ethic in training.

“He is a great fella and when he wasn’t in the team because of the form of Chris, he wasn’t moaning or groaning that he wasn’t in the team. He said that he was watching and learning and that is a terrific to hear and see for any manager.

He added: “Chuma has set the example of showing what needs to be done when there chance comes along. The players need to be ready and Chuma has been the perfect example of that.”
